VisualLace 06-15-2008 02:40 AM

Wow, that's a lot of... eyeliner... lashes- whoa! The liner looks similar to what was in Misa's make-up tutorial, just maybe a little heavier. And the lashes you could probably find at a costume/party shop, Hot Topic, or just about anywhere near Halloween. On her lower eye make-up, she put the lashes (and maybe liner, but it's hard to tell) on lower than her natural lash line along the outer half, which makes her eyes look dramatically bigger (but looks a bit strange if you really look at it).

To make your eyes look a little bigger without so much make-up, you could line the rim of your lower eyelid with white liner, then apply mascara (black eyeliner optional). Rimmel white liner works nicely on me.
